Holland Beat Mexico, Through to World Cup Quarters: Daily

By Robbie Blakeley, Senior Contributing Reporter

RIO DE JANEIRO, BRAZIL - A 94th minute penalty from Klaas-Jan Huntelaar gave Holland a 2-1 win over Mexico this afternoon at the Arena Castelão. The Dutch were just minutes from crashing out of the World Cup but turned the tie on its head in the closing stages.
